With today's modern PACS, there is still a need for routing. PACSwareŽ DICOM Router can be configured to perform
"store and forward" routing of images sent into the application.
PACSwareŽ DICOM Router is extremely configurable
and can be used to perform image compression/decompression over WAN, image
duplication and fanout, as well as routing based on DICOM metadata in the
input image stream.
PACSwareŽ DICOM Router provides the
following benefits:
-
routing based on DICOM metadata
in the image/study to be routed (including but not limited to, modality,
body part, priority, requesting physician and referring physician)
-
routing based on time of day
and/or study time
-
routes studies to multiple destinations
based on configurable routing rules
-
able to route studies to any DICOM
Storage provider
-
supports DICOM conformant
lossless compression
-
supports DICOM conformant lossy
JPEG/DCT compression
-
supports Pegasus wavelet
compression
-
compression configurable on a
route by route basis and depends on modality and body part
-
splits mammography studies into
series based on laterality and view (for improved viewing station
hanging protocols)
